Output bcaa87c2cc3fccf36734c0ffac0e46ca37004dea24f5230fa71ce65663f5e3a5:6

value
617739
script pubkey
OP_0 OP_PUSHBYTES_20 3fee2364625ec705833220d264c32bb4f70ddaef
address
bc1q8lhzxerztmrstqejyrfxfsetknmsmkh0vpxea6
transaction
bcaa87c2cc3fccf36734c0ffac0e46ca37004dea24f5230fa71ce65663f5e3a5
confirmations
188438
spent
true